Hosted by Kelly Zugay of With Grace and Gold, The Brand It, Build It Podcast equips you to grow your creative small business with purpose and strategy. Since 2014, With Grace and Gold® has served small business owners, photographers, and wedding professionals through award-winning, elevated, luxury custom brand and web design services.
